Contribution of TWIK-Related Acid-Sensitive K(+) Channel 1 (TASK1) and TASK3 Channels to the Control of Activity Modes in Thalamocortical Neurons
The thalamocortical network is characterized by rhythmic burst activity during natural sleep and tonic single-spike activity during wakefulness.
